How do you winterize a Landroid?

In order to winterize a Landroid, there are a few steps you should take to ensure it will be ready for the colder months ahead.

First, you should make sure all of the blades are securely attached and the lawnmower is clean. This is to make sure that no dirt or debris will build up in the internal components which could cause it to malfunction.

Second, you should charge the battery to full capacity before storing it away. This will keep the battery in optimal condition throughout the winter months and ensure it is able to power the Landroid when you bring it out in the spring.

Third, you should cover the Landroid to protect it from inclement weather. This could be done with a waterproof tarp, or by storing it inside a dry, covered location.

Finally, you should lubricate all the necessary parts, such as the blades, to protect them from corrosion and rust. This will help keep your Landroid running smoothly once you are ready to take it out for a spin.

By following these steps, you can winterize your Landroid and make sure it is ready for use when the weather warms up.

What sensors does the robot lawn mower have?

Robot lawn mowers typically have a variety of sensors, which allow them to safely and efficiently navigate through a yard while avoiding potential obstacles. These sensors can include collision sensors, which detect objects in the lawn mower’s path and trigger an automated reaction to avoid contact.

Additionally, infrared sensors can detect changes in the terrain, allowing the robot lawn mower to adjust its course accordingly. Finally, other sensors can detect changes in the weather and the current mowing conditions, allowing the robot to automatically adjust its trajectory, speed, or mowing frequency as needed.
